Overview Pregakon 200mg Tablet SR

Progesterone 200mg Extended-Release tablets (brand name: Pregakon) are a naturally-occurring female hormone used to manage menstrual and pregnancy complications stemming from hormonal fluctuations. Follow your physician's instructions precisely regarding dosage and duration; continued use may be advised post-pregnancy confirmation. Common side effects encompass headaches, fatigue, abdominal cramps and pain, nausea, bloating, reduced libido, and vaginal pain or discharge. Your healthcare provider can assist in managing these effects. Though rare, serious allergic reactions necessitate immediate medical attention. Increased risks of blood clots and breast cancer are associated with this medication. Consult your doctor if you have a history of breast cancer, unusual vaginal bleeding, or liver disease; close monitoring is warranted for pre-existing liver, kidney, heart, diabetic, or asthmatic conditions. A complete medical history is crucial. Inform your doctor about all other medications to avoid interactions. Regular uterine examinations are standard pre- and during treatment. Drowsiness and altered cognitive function are possible; caution is advised when driving or engaging in activities requiring alertness. Alcohol consumption is generally discouraged during treatment.

How to use Pregakon 200mg Tablet SR:

Follow your doctor's instructions precisely regarding dosage and treatment length for this medication. Ingest the 200mg Pregakon SR tablet whole; avoid chewing, crushing, or breaking it. Administer on an empty stomach.

How Pregakon 200mg Tablet SR works:

Progesterone 200mg sustained-release tablets (Pregakon) are a female hormone that supports uterine lining development. This medication aids in pregnancy establishment and maintenance for women experiencing infertility. Furthermore, it mitigates estrogen's adverse effects on the uterus in postmenopausal women.

What if you forget to take Pregakon 200mg Tablet SR :

Should you forget a Pregakon 200mg SR Tablet dose, administer it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
